About Regional Stabilized Strains

Regional stabilized strains represent cannabis cultivars that have been cultivated and refined within specific geographic areas over extended periods, developing distinct phenotypic and chemotypic characteristics suited to local growing conditions. These strains emerge through repeated open-pollination, selection, and seed-saving practices within isolated populations, often resulting in stable trait expression across generations. Examples include Afghani landrace lines, Thai stick varieties, and Colombian highland strains—each shaped by unique climate, altitude, and soil conditions. Breeders studying regional stabilized strains document valuable genetic markers for environmental adaptation, cannabinoid ratios, and terpene profiles that reflect generations of natural selection. Breeder relevance

Breeders incorporate regional stabilized genetics to introduce locally-adapted vigor, disease resistance, and environmental tolerance into new crosses. These foundational strains provide stable baselines for hybridization programs seeking specific terpene or cannabinoid profiles while maintaining cultivation reliability.
